Qualifications
Minimum 2 years of recent acute care ER leadership experience
BSN required; MSN preferred
Active RN license in Texas or compact state with temporary TX permit
Current BLS, ACLS, and PALS (or ENPC) certifications
National certification in emergency nursing or critical care (CEN, CCRN) preferred
Clinical practice in ER within the past 3 years required
